RULING

1. The accused is charged with murder contrary to section 203 as read with section 204 of the Penal Code.

2. The particulars are that on the 28th May 2012, at Uswa village, Kaplolo Location, Moiben Division, Uasin Gishu District of the Rift Valley Province, he murdered Moses Kiza Khisa.

3. He pleaded notguilty. The prosecution called sixwitnesses. I have considered the circumstantial evidence surrounding the homicide. I am alive that no eye witness came forward. Nevertheless, I have paid close attention to the evidence of PW3, PW4, PW5 and PW6. I have also considered the submissions by the learned prosecution counsel filed on 9th February 2017; and, those by the learned defence counsel filed on 13th February 2017.

4. On the summation of the evidence of the six witnesses; and, in particular that of PW6, I am persuaded that the Republic has established a prima facie case against the accused.  See Bhatt v Republic [1957] E.A. 332, R v Kipkering arap Koske & another 16 EACA 135 (1949).

5. Accordingly, under the provisions of section 306 (2) of the Criminal Procedure Code, I put the accused on his defence.

It is so ordered.
